The short version

Woodlands is significantly wealthier than the US average, with a median household income of $133,553. Population has grown 38% since 2011. 41%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, well above the national rate of 28%. Median home value is $653,400. With a median age of 59.2, the population is older than the US median of 37.2. Households here earn about 119% more than the California median.

Frequently asked

How many people live in Woodlands, California?

Woodlands, California has about 576 residents according to the 2010 American Community Survey.

What is the median household income in Woodlands, California?

The typical household in Woodlands, California earns about $133,553 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is Woodlands, California expensive?

In Woodlands, California, the median home is worth about $653,400.

How educated are people in Woodlands, California?

About 40.5% of adults age 25 and over in Woodlands, California h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in Woodlands, California?

About 10.5% of people in Woodlands, California live below the federal poverty line.
